Ruatangata

The May meeting of the Ruatangata Institute was held in the hall. Mrs. Hodge presided over a fair attendance. One visitor was present. The roll call “My Favourite Motto” was well responded to. A competition arranged by Miss L. Hodge was won by Mrs. Hodge, and another, for the prettiest cake plate, was won by Mrs Birdling. Miss L. Hodges gave the golden thread. A presentation was made to Mrs. Cossill, president, for her services during the previous three years. A demonstration for a quick way to re-foot a sock was given by Mrs. Hodge. Members brought along patchwork squares for the quilt the institute iS making. Afternoon tea brought a pleasant afternoon to a close. Hostesses were Mesdames Yates and Birdling.
